Vision and Mission

Aim

Since 1987, when the Hotel and Restaurant Association of Assam was incorporated as a company limited by guarantee and without share capital, the Association has served the interests of the hotel and restaurant industry. Over the years, it has taken effective steps to encourage, promote, and protect the interests of its member establishments. It aims to render professional assistance from time to time to all its members on topics of vital importance.

Vision

To plan, promote, and protect by lawful means the interests of the hotel and restaurant industry of Assam.

Mission

To secure for the hotel industry its due place in India’s economy and highlight its role as a contributor to employment generation and sustainable economic and social development; to emphasise its crucial role in serving Assam’s tourism industry; to help raise the standards of hoteliering; and to build a strong image for this industry both within and outside the state.

Objectives

  1. To create awareness of the significance of the hotel industry in contributing to the growth of tourism in the state, overall economic development, and employment generation.

  2. To secure for the industry its rightful status as a core infrastructure sector.

  3. To highlight the challenges faced by the hotel industry in Assam and take them up effectively at appropriate levels.

  4. To serve members by establishing a data bank that provides timely information, advisory services, and research support.

  5. To formulate strategies in areas such as land, finance, taxation, training, procedures, and legislation to accelerate growth.

  6. To ensure better services and facilities for tourists and maintain reputable standards in the hotel industry through education and training of members and their employees.

  7. To discourage unfair competition among members, while not interfering with fair enterprise and initiative.

  8. To adjudicate and settle disputes among members whenever its arbitration is jointly requested by the concerned parties.

  9. To liaise with central and state governments and other authorities on issues concerning the hotel industry.

  10. To collaborate with all segments of the hotel industry and apex tourism bodies in Assam, the Northeast, and India to create a common platform.

  11. To help protect and conserve the culture, traditions, and environment of the region.

  12. To work together with other associations or organisations to facilitate the fulfillment of the objectives of the Association.

  13. To contribute to the development of tourism in the region.

  14. To take appropriate legal steps to safeguard and protect the interests of members.
